Help your puppy shine at puppy school

  

Instruction and interaction during the first six to eight months of development ensures that a puppy readily absorbs information from its social and physical environment.

  

Blakehurst Vets' puppy school gets them started on the road to good socialisation and is tailored to suit the participants with positive reinforcement, short segments and social time.

  

Because your puppy undoubtedly has a short attention span, activities and learning exercises are brief in puppy class with an emphasis on fun.

  

While puppy classes are generally about socialising with other dogs, our classes also have a focus on puppies socialising with people and family members are encouraged to attend giving puppies the chance to learn to interact with family members of all ages.
